MEMORANDUM OPINION
Lauren Kathleen Brown, acting pro se, has filed a motion to dismiss her
appeal. See Tex. R. App. P. 42.2. A request to dismiss the appeal is signed by
appellant personally. No opinion has issued in this appeal. The motion is granted,
and the appeal is therefore dismissed.
APPEAL DISMISSED.
